Automatic Determination of Water Hardness by Vector Colorimetry with Acid Chrome Blue K

Abstract
Based on the Mg2 + complexation with acid chrome blue K (ACBK) at pH 10.2, an automatic system was designed to determine total hardness of water. The system consists of a vector colorimeter, a multi-channel sampling pump and both reagents A and B. Two kinds of reagent solutions were prepared and used in this system, i.e., ammoniacal buffer and ACBK-disodium magnesium EDTA solutions. The experimental results of the standard solutions containing 2 and 3 mg/L of total hardness showed that the relative standard deviations (RSDs) were 1.9% and 2.2%, respectively, and the limit of detection (LOD) was only 0.035 mg/L. The detection of four natural water samples showed that the recoveries were between 85.0% and 108.6%, consistent with those obtained by ICP-AES method.
